This file was contributed for use in the WIGenWeb Archives by: Rosemarie Novak 4 September 2008 ========================================================== From: ANDERSON-FIREHAMMER MARRIAGE: On Thurs., Nov. 25, at high noon, Charlotte (Firehammer) & Edwin O. Anderson were united in the holy bonds of matrimony by Rev. Thorson at the home the groom had prepared for his bride at Prairie Farm. The Bride was dressed in white satin & was attended by her sister Esther & Alvena Anderson sister of the groom. The Groom was attired in the conventional black & was attended by his brother Herman & his friend John Nelson. After the ceremony a sumptuous dinner was served, covers being laid for 40 guests. The Groom is a graduate of the Dunn County Agricultural School. The Bride has been a successful teacher in our schools for the past 7 yrs. The happy couple received many gifts from their relatives & friends & all join in wishing them happiness in their new home.
